drawn as much as I had before coming out here
together with the $800 - which I have recieved [received] since
I arrived here prior to the 17th July /53.

The 1st of Dec I recd [received] a draft from Mr. T of $1000
& the 1st inst another draft for the same amount &
he writes that there is still a balance due me
of $276.74 independent of the Real Estate, which is
better news than I expected to hear --

I suppose that Esq J. or Mr Tucker will tell you
all about the settlement but for fear they might
not & thinking that you & Chas might like to hear
how affairs stand I will give you a brief state-
ment of the matter.

Esq J has not charged one percent a year, on the
property, but one per cent on the whole amount then
$50 per year for the loss of interest &c. for 8 years which
amounts to $400. His charge for taking care of the
property renting &c ($10. per year) I think is very
moderate. There have been some few losses on the es-
tate which are charged to the estate, but which I always
thought Esq J. was accountable for & Mr. T. thought
so too, so in order to be satisfied he took the account
to an attorney in Boston & got him to examine it
& he decided that Esq J. was entitled to the allowance
which he claimed, so I am perfectly satisfied as the
losses were comparatively small, & were as follows:
On Fanoell Farsan Note of $97.31 was lost $75.32
On Kendall Davis Note of $204.65 " [was] " [lost] $153.49

Account against Warren Wood 53.46
292.27
